Output 8a66341a87c6f3439cb29020d8a2c2b386860f1ead27b388dd20aacd73cfecba:1

value
1980126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 340686ef19d0414f99bcc1c0f432fb9744aaa274 OP_EQUALVERIFY OP_CHECKSIG
address
15k5xV8k29Qcb7z4QWYGmQrbPGDFZHJr2c
transaction
8a66341a87c6f3439cb29020d8a2c2b386860f1ead27b388dd20aacd73cfecba
confirmations
449968
spent
true